EASY MEXICAN CASSEROLE



HI! So it has been quite a while since I have last written in here. I am going to try to keep up with this more. Beginning with something I have in the oven as I type this. Last night I made tacos and since I cook for one having leftover tacos for the next 4 days does not sound very appealing to me, so I decided to make it into a casserole. It is very easy to make and pretty inexpensive and you all can make it into your own unique dish.

INGREDIENTS:
ground beef
taco seasoning
tostitos chips
purple onion (chopped)
avocado (chopped)
tomato (chopped)
sour cream
picante sauce
jalapenos
cheddar cheese
mozzarella cheese
--Remember... you can include or exclude any of the above ingredients, and add what you like... like maybe you enjoy beans, black olives, etc. I didn't put measurements on above because you are just going to layer all of them

DIRECTIONS:
Preheat your oven to 350 degrees
Cook your ground beef and mix in your choice of taco seasoning
Take a pan... mine is 4x6 clear glass... and put in your chips... I crushed mine in my hands as I filled the bottom up until I couldn't see the bottom anymore.
Next, layer the cooked ground beef on that and continue with the rest of the layers. (I layered mine: chips, taco meat, tomatoes (1 chopped), purple onion (1/2 of one chopped), jalapenos (I used 3 small ones chopped), sour cream (until the entire thing was covered white), picante sauce (made a layer), avocado chunks (1 chopped- wish I had 2), layered with cheddar cheese and mozzarella cheese until i couldn't see anything but cheese.
Put in the oven for 20- 30 minutes or until melted and bubbly.
